This week I would like to discuss briefly House Bill 130 since I know that the well being of our senior community is so very important to each and every one of us.   Over the last four years, Maryland's nursing homes absorbed $120 million in cuts. These cuts limited access and restricted services for Medicaid recipients – who represented 62% of Maryland's nursing home patients in FY 2003 (the most recent data available). HB 130, an administration bill, seeks to restore some of those cuts by boosting Medicaid payments for nursing home stays.  The bill would authorize the Department of Health & Mental Hygiene to levy an assessment on nursing home facilities' quarterly profits, excluding Medicare income.  The revenue generated, an estimated $21.3 million, would be used to leverage federal matching funds, allowing the state to increase Medicaid nursing facility provider rates by $42.6 million in FY 2008.
